Understanding the SaaS Sales Funnel

At the heart of any sales methodology lies the sales funnel. In the context of SaaS, the sales funnel represents the journey a prospect takes from initial awareness to becoming a loyal customer. Understanding the different stages of the sales funnel and aligning sales efforts accordingly is crucial for success.

Prospecting: Finding the Right Leads

Prospecting involves identifying and targeting potential customers who are most likely to benefit from your SaaS offering. Leveraging various lead-generation techniques such as content marketing, social media, and referrals can help you build a pipeline of qualified leads.

Qualification: Identifying Ideal Customers

Not all leads are created equal. Qualification is the process of determining whether a lead is a good fit for your SaaS solution. By defining clear criteria and establishing an ideal customer profile, you can focus your efforts on prospects who are most likely to convert into paying customers.

Product Demonstration: Showcasing Value Proposition

Once you have identified qualified leads, it’s essential to effectively showcase the unique value proposition of your SaaS product. Utilize interactive product demonstrations, personalized presentations, and customer success stories to highlight the benefits and address specific pain points of your target audience.

Handling Objections: Overcoming Customer Concerns

During the sales process, prospects may raise objections or express concerns. Addressing these objections in a timely and empathetic manner is critical to maintaining momentum and building trust. Anticipate common objections and prepare persuasive responses that align with your SaaS solution’s capabilities.

Closing the Deal: Securing the Sale

Closing a SaaS sale often involves a subscription-based model or a contractual agreement. Develop a systematic approach to closing deals that includes clear pricing structures, flexible contract terms, and a streamlined negotiation process. Emphasize the value your SaaS product brings and provide compelling reasons for prospects to choose your solution over competitors.

Onboarding: Ensuring a Smooth Transition

Effective onboarding is key to reducing churn and maximizing customer satisfaction. Develop an onboarding process that helps new customers quickly integrate and derive value from your SaaS product. Provide comprehensive training materials, proactive support, and regular check-ins to ensure a smooth transition.

Upselling and Cross-selling: Maximizing Customer Value

SaaS companies have a unique advantage in generating recurring revenue through upselling and cross-selling opportunities. Identify opportunities to offer additional features, upgrades, or complementary products to existing customers, thereby increasing their lifetime value.

Customer Success: Retaining and Growing Customer Relationships

In the SaaS world, customer success is crucial for long-term growth. Develop a customer success strategy that focuses on delivering exceptional value and achieving desired outcomes for your customers. Proactively engage with customers, provide ongoing support, and leverage data-driven insights to identify opportunities for improvement.

Sales Analytics: Measuring and Optimizing Performance

Utilize sales analytics tools to track key performance metrics, such as conversion rates, customer acquisition costs, and revenue growth. Analyze the data to gain insights into the effectiveness of your sales methodology and identify areas for improvement. Regularly review and refine your approach based on data-driven feedback.

Hiring and Training a High-Performing Sales Team

Building a high-performing sales team is a critical component of successful SaaS sales. Hire individuals who possess a deep understanding of the SaaS industry, excellent communication skills, and a passion for delivering exceptional customer experiences. Provide ongoing training and professional development opportunities to equip your sales team with the necessary knowledge and skills.

Continuous Improvement: Learning from Success and Failure

The SaaS industry is constantly evolving, and your sales methodology should adapt accordingly. Encourage a culture of continuous improvement within your sales team. Regularly analyze successes and failures, gather feedback from customers and team members, and iterate on your sales processes to stay ahead of the competition.
